易语言网络封包拦截与修改实现教程

需积分: 50 14 下载量 38 浏览量 更新于2024-10-30 1 收藏 345KB ZIP 举报
资源摘要信息:"易语言-网络封包拦截修改源码-仿WPE" 易语言是一种基于中文的编程语言,它具有易学易用的特点,使得编程更加亲民化。本资源所提供的易语言源码主要是针对网络封包的拦截和修改,实现网络数据的监控与控制,这一功能在游戏作弊器、网络监控等领域有着广泛的应用。源码实现了仿WPE功能,即模仿了Windows Packet Editor(WPE)工具的网络封包处理能力。 WPE是一款网络封包编辑软件,它能够捕捉和修改通过本地网络接口的封包,常用于测试网络游戏。它通过截获网络数据包并提供修改、重放等操作来实现对网络通信过程的控制。易语言通过网络拦截支持库和扩展界面支持库,调用相关的API函数,使用户能够以易语言的方式实现类似于WPE的功能,而无需依赖专门的网络封包编辑软件。 网络封包的拦截和修改是网络编程中的高级功能,它涉及到底层网络协议的理解和操作。在本资源中,源码通过易语言的网络拦截支持库来监听网络数据包。网络拦截支持库通常包括了一系列的网络接口函数,用于捕获和处理网络数据包。这些函数可能包括创建监听socket,绑定IP和端口,以及读取、发送和修改数据包等。 扩展界面支持库在易语言中提供了创建自定义界面的能力,这样用户可以构建出更为友好和直观的操作界面,使网络封包的监控和修改操作更为便捷。用户通过图形用户界面(GUI)可以更加直观地查看和选择需要拦截或修改的网络数据包,而不需要直接处理底层的网络数据。 本资源的网络封包拦截修改源码-仿WPE,适用于需要对网络数据进行深入分析和调试的场景。例如,网络开发人员可能需要对通信协议进行测试,以确保数据的正确性和安全性。此外,安全研究人员也可能会用到此类工具进行网络通信的安全性评估。 易语言的易用性使得即使是初学者也能够在较短的时间内掌握网络封包拦截修改的编程技能。源码不仅提供了一套完整的操作框架,同时也为深入理解网络通信和数据包处理提供了一个实践平台。 总体来说,网络封包拦截修改源码-仿WPE具有以下重要知识点: 1. 网络封包拦截原理:了解如何监听网络数据包,理解TCP/IP协议栈和网络通信流程。 2. 易语言编程:掌握易语言的基本语法、网络编程接口以及界面设计。 3. API函数调用:熟练使用网络拦截支持库提供的API函数,进行数据包的读取、分析和修改。 4. 数据包解析:能够解析网络数据包的结构,识别出有用的信息,并对特定数据进行修改。 5. 用户界面设计:使用扩展界面支持库设计直观的操作界面,使用户能够方便地进行封包拦截和修改。 6. 网络安全与监控:了解网络封包拦截修改在网络安全和监控领域中的应用场景及其重要性。 通过深入研究和实践本资源提供的易语言网络封包拦截修改源码,不仅可以提升对网络通信的控制能力,同时也能够在网络应用开发中实现更高级的功能。